稀疏矩阵如下图所示,分别画出存放该矩阵的三元组顺序表和十字链表。 12 -3 24 18 -7 相关知识点: 试题来源: 解析 解:三元组表示法如图所示: a 1 2 3 6 7 5 1 1 12 2 2 5 3、 3 3 3 24 4 4 1 18 5 4 5 7、 十字链表略。
MaxTerms row(行号) 1 2 2 3 4 5 5 6 col(列号) 2 4 7 1 4 2 6 4 val(元素值) 4 -3 1 8 5 -7 2 6 ⑶给出它的转置矩阵的三元组线性表和顺序存储表示; ((1,3,8),(2,1,4),(2,5,-7),(4,2,-3),(4,4,5),(4,6,6),(6,5,2),(7,2,1)) 下标 1 2 3 4 5 6 ...
若采用三元组顺序表来压缩存储稀疏矩阵,只要把每个三元组的行下标和列下标互换,就完成了对该矩阵的转置运算。A.正确B.错误
三元组表示为:N=((1,5,2),(1,6,8),(2,4,7),(3,2,5),(4,1,6),(5,5,1),(6,2,2),(6,5,4),(7,6,8))
5 4 3 A) 该稀疏矩阵有8列 B) 该稀疏矩阵有7列 C) 该稀疏矩阵有9个非0元素 D) 该稀疏矩阵的第3行第6列的值为0相关知识点: 试题来源: 解析 B [解析] 该稀疏矩阵有7列;稀疏矩阵有7个非0元素;该稀疏矩阵的第3行第6列的值为1。反馈 收藏 ...
解析:三元组是指形如((x,y),z)的集合(这就是说,三元组zhi是这样的偶,其第一个射影亦是一个偶),常简记为(x,y,z)。三元组是计算机专业的一门公共基础课程——数据结构里的概念。主要是用来存储稀疏矩阵的一种压缩方式,也叫三元组表。假设以顺序存储结构来表示三元组表(triple table),则得到稀疏矩阵的一...
4 3 135 2 186 1 156 7 8 相关知识点: 试题来源: 解析 你三元组法写的就不正确!你应该把横纵坐标数也写出来比如你定义i为7,j为7,则矩阵为0 12 9 0 0 0 00 0 0 0 5 0 0-3 0 0 0 0 14 00 0 13 0 0 0 00 18 0 0 0 0 015 0 0 0 0 0 80 0 0 0 0 0 0...
如下是一个稀疏矩阵的三元组法存储表示和相关的叙述: 行下标 列下标 值 1 2 6 2 4 7 2 1 4 3 2 6 4 4 1 5 2 1 5 3 6Ⅰ. 该稀疏矩阵有5行Ⅱ. 该稀疏矩阵有4列Ⅲ.该稀疏矩阵有7个非0元素这些叙述中哪个(些)是正确的是 (36) 。 A.只有ⅠB.Ⅰ和ⅡC.只有ⅢD.Ⅰ、Ⅱ和Ⅲ 相关知识点:...
4. 在稀疏矩阵的三元组顺序表中,每个三元组表示( )。A、矩阵中数据元素的行号、列号和数据值B、矩阵中非零元素的数据值C、矩阵中数据元素的行号和列号D、矩阵中非零元素的行号、列号和数据值搜索 题目 4. 在稀疏矩阵的三元组顺序表中,每个三元组表示( )。 A、矩阵中数据元素的行号、列号和数据值 B、...
若稀疏矩阵A[1…m,1…n]采用三元组顺序表示, 要实现矩阵的转置,只需要把三元组中有关行下标与列下标的值互换就可以了A.正确B.错误